Ashok Leyland shares gain 3% as board to consider bonus issue on May 23
Ashok Leyland shares rose 3.4% to their day’s high of Rs 249.65 on the BSE on Tuesday after the company said its board is likely to consider a proposal for issuing bonus shares at its upcoming meeting on Friday, May 23. The commercial vehicle maker will also announce its financial results for the quarter and year ended March 31, 2025, on the same day.
“At the meeting dated 23rd May 2025, the Board of Directors may consider the proposal for issue of bonus shares, subject to requisite approvals,” the company said in an exchange filing post-market hours on Monday, May 19.
